我有开发需求
联系电话:
*-
8+1等于
巡检软件外包开发步骤
随着信息技术的不断发展,越来越多的企业选择将软件开发业务外包给专业的软件开发公司。巡检软件作为一种提高企业生产效率、降低运营成本的有力工具,逐渐受到企业的重视。本文将详细介绍巡检软件外包开发的步骤,以帮助企业更好地进行巡检软件开发。
一、需求分析
需求分析是软件开发的第一步,也是最为关键的一步。在这一阶段,企业需要明确自身的需求,包括巡检软件的功能、性能、用户界面、操作方式等方面。需求分析需要深入了解企业的生产流程、管理模式以及实际需求,确保软件能够满足企业的使用需求。此外,需求分析还要考虑软件的可扩展性、易维护性、安全性等因素,以保证软件能够长期稳定运行。
二、项目规划
项目规划阶段主要是对软件开发项目进行详细的计划和安排。首先,根据需求分析结果,明确项目的开发目标、开发周期、开发预算等。其次,制定项目的开发计划,包括项目进度、人员分工、资源分配等内容。最后,根据项目计划,制定项目的风险管理计划,以应对可能出现的风险。
三、系统设计
系统设计阶段是根据需求分析结果,设计软件的整体结构和各个模块的功能。系统设计主要包括软件架构设计、模块划分、接口定义等内容。在设计过程中,要充分考虑软件的可维护性、可扩展性、安全性等因素,确保软件能够满足企业的长期需求。
四、软件开发
软件开发阶段是根据系统设计,进行实际的编程工作。这一阶段主要包括编码、单元测试、集成测试等内容。在编码过程中,开发人员需要遵循编程规范,保证代码的质量。单元测试和集成测试是对软件功能和性能的验证,确保软件能够满足需求。
五、系统测试与验收
系统测试阶段是对整个软件系统进行测试,以验证软件的功能、性能、稳定性等方面是否满足需求。系统测试主要包括功能测试、性能测试、兼容性测试、安全性测试等。在测试过程中,需要对测试结果进行详细的记录和分析,找出软件存在的问题,并进行相应的修复。验收阶段是对软件进行最终确认,确保软件满足企业的需求,可以正式投入使用。
六、系统部署与维护
系统部署阶段是将软件安装到企业的生产环境中,并进行相关的配置。在这一阶段,需要确保软件能够顺利地与其他系统进行集成,并能够在生产环境中稳定运行。系统维护阶段是对软件进行持续的更新和维护,确保软件能够长期稳定运行。维护工作包括软件升级、故障排查、性能优化等内容。
总结
巡检软件外包开发需要经历需求分析、项目规划、系统设计、软件开发、系统测试与验收、系统部署与维护等多个阶段。企业在进行巡检软件开发时,需要对每个阶段的工作进行充分的了解和准备,确保软件能够满足企业的需求,提高企业的生产效率。开发邦长期为客户提供巡检软件软件开发服务,满足客户对巡检软件的个性化需求。开发邦巡检软件支持内网部署、私有云部署、公有云部署,支持根据客户个性化需求进行巡检软件定制开发,支持定制开发移动端和微信端,提供巡检软件软件开发服务,提供长期的运营技术维护和售后技术支持。
- 开发邦 专业软件定制开发服务
- 电话:189-1061-4217
- 点击拨打电话
- 微信:kaifabangbj
- 点击复制微信号
- QQ:1974355859